Troubleshooting Common Edge Banding Difficulties
When utilizing edge banding to furniture , various problems can arise themselves. A typical problem is noticeable separations between the band and the substrate . This might be due to inadequate bonding agent placement, fluctuating contact, or a mismatch in wood movement. Another typical issue includes distortions in the material, often resulting from excessive heat during the application procedure . Finally, lifting of the strip can point to poor surface Edge Banding Machines cleaning , like residue or existing finish . Careful attention to all stage of the method and appropriate devices are necessary for positive outcomes .
